visit of the town of agen:st. caprais cathedral
St. Caprais Cathedral - The purity of the roman chevet is exceptional
The Tower of Notre Dame du Chapelet - the oldest monument still visible
The "Place des Laitiers" - was the forum of the old Gallo-Roman town and the square of the original St. Etienne Cathedral
The Jewish Alley - the old medieval banking centre, strategically situated between the commercial and residential quarters
Boat trip in from the charming baïse
As well as the modern Lateral canal, the Agen region is at the hub of more than 300km of navigable waterways : from the charming Baïse, which takes you right to the edge of the Pyrenees, to the majestic Lot, which will soon be open as far as Conques in the Aveyron

The caves of fontirou of agen
The caves of Fontirou whose aventure started 30 million years ago, offer to the glances visitors an uninterrupted succession of concretions of all forms and varied colours and brilliance of thousand fires under a judicious lighting.

sites around agen
Clermont Dessous - The defensive position of this fortified site allowed its occupants to control the river traffic on the Garonne below
Bazens - it was the court of the Bishop of Agen, Matteo Bandello (1480-1561), in the 16th century
Prayssas - A circular medieval village with four gateways, famous for its chasselas grapes
Lacépède - from the Latin cepium, a garden or orchard, a village nestling among wooded valleys and chasselas vineyards
Montpezat - Perched on its promontory, this is the only Bastide of English origin in the Department
The feudal Madaillan Castle - A fine example of medieval military architecture with the earliest parts dating back to the 13th century
The gravier, once an island of agen
The Gravier was once an island and up until the 14th century its shape and size fluctuated with the Garonne floods.From the time of Louis XIII onwards, it has been the site of the area's most important fairs. The esplanade was restored in 1753 and in the first half of the 19th century and today forms a pleasant promenade, which incorporates the new flood protection barrier.
